      The recruiter scheduled an initial interview and explained the hiring process. It was very similar to Big Tech interviews, but I found the salary low compared to the level of effort required for the process, and also for the local market. I was not excited to move forward, but recruiter was persistent and encouraged me to reconsider. I accepted. To take part in the process, you need to set aside at least around four hours, which can be split across different days. However, the available time slots were only during business hours. If you are currently employed, you need to make time for that. I went through the interview process, but I did not receive any feedback for weeks. I tried to follow up and received no response. That’s okay, I understand this can be common in the market. However, a few weeks later, I received an email apologizing. They said they were understaffed and asked whether I would like to receive feedback. I said yes, and then I was ghosted again. I was surprised when they asked whether I wanted feedback, and then fail to follow through again. Overall, the experience felt disorganized and inconsistent with the expectations set by such a demanding hiring process.

      I applied online.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at TomTom (Amsterdam) in Apr 2026

      Interview

      2 interview rounds. 1st - technical object oriented design 2nd - 3 interviews - technical and object oriented design; behavioral and DSA style questions. Behavioral questions are "Recall a time when..."

      Half hour behavioral questions + half hour live coding, the procedure is very standardized and similar to what Amazon is doing, the last round is very pressuring, consisting of three rounds of one hour process with 15 minutes of break in between
